About This Service
Hannah's Home is a Christ-centered maternity home and program for single pregnant young women ages 18 and over. The organization provides a safe and nurturing environment designed to support emotional, physical, psychological, and spiritual growth. Their services include Bible study, mentorship, life skills training, job readiness training, and onsite and offsite daycare services. In addition, they offer counseling, assistance with decision-making, and emotional support for mothers who have experienced pregnancy or infant loss, as well as post-abortion healing and grief support. The organization is fully funded and supported by private donations from individuals, churches, businesses, and grants.
